Hogyan vehet fel „Take Ownership” -t a Windows Intéző jobb oldali menüjébe
A Windows rendszerben lévő fájlok vagy mappák tulajdonjogának megadása nem egyszerű. Mind a GUI, mind a parancssor túl sok lépést tesz. Miért ne adjunk hozzá egy egyszerű kontextus menüparancsot, amely lehetővé teszi bármely fájl vagy mappa tulajdonjogát?
Hozzáadhat egy „Take Ownership” parancsot a helyi menüjéhez úgy, hogy a rendszerleíró adatbázist kézzel, két helyen - egy fájlban, a második pedig a mappákban szerkeszti. Egyszerûen letölthetjük az egylépéses rendszerleíró adatbázisokat, hogy ezeket a változtatásokat az Ön számára elvégezzük.
A Windows rendszerben a fájl vagy mappa tulajdonában lévő felhasználó implicit jogokkal rendelkezik az adott objektum jogosultságainak módosítására. Ez a felhasználó mindig is hozzáférhet a fájlhoz vagy mappához, még akkor is, ha más jogosultságok látszólag ellentmondanak ennek a hozzáférésnek. Néha előfordulhat, hogy olyan helyzetbe kerül, ahol át kell vennie egy fájl vagy mappa tulajdonjogát. Lehet, hogy egy rendszerfájl, amelyet meg kell változtatnia ahhoz, hogy néhány hack-szerű helyettesítő Jegyzettömböt egy másik szövegszerkesztővel alkalmazzon - ebben az esetben a Trusted Installer nevű beépített felhasználói fiók alapértelmezés szerint tulajdonosa. Vagy lehet, hogy egy másik merevlemez-meghajtót is be kell töltenie a fájlok ellenőrzéséhez.
Bármi is legyen az ok, a tulajdonjogot a különböző Windows-engedélyek párbeszédpaneljei vagy a Parancssor segítségével használhatja. De mindkét módszernek több lépést kell végrehajtania. A rendszerleíró adatbázis néhány módosításával azonban egy egyszerű „Take Ownership” parancsot adhat hozzá a File Explorer helyi menüjéhez, amely lehetővé teszi, hogy egy lépésben vegye fel a felelősséget. Megmutatjuk Önnek a manuális módszert a módosítások nyilvántartásba vételéhez, de van egy egylépcsős hackje is, amellyel ezeket a változtatásokat problémamentesen telepítheti..
jegyzet: A cikk technikája a Windows legtöbb verziójában működik a Vista-tól egészen 7, 8 és 10-ig.
Adja meg a „Take Ownership” (szerkesztés) funkciót a rendszerleíró adatbázis szerkesztésével
Ahhoz, hogy a „Take Ownership” parancsot a Windows bármelyik változatának helyi menüjébe adhassa, csak néhány változtatást kell tennie a Windows rendszerleíró adatbázisában. Ez egy igazi lista a változásokról, és két külön nyilvántartási helyen fog dolgozni. De vegye idejét, kövesse a lépéseket, és odaér. És ha nem szeretné magát a változtatásokat elvégezni, akkor ugorjon előre, és csak töltse le az egylépéses hackjeinket. Javasoljuk azonban, hogy legalább ezt a fejezetet átfedjék, így megértheted a végrehajtott változtatásokat.
Standard figyelmeztetés: A rendszerleíróadatbázis-szerkesztő egy hatékony eszköz, és a visszaélés miatt a rendszer instabil vagy akár nem működőképes. Ez egy nagyon egyszerű hack, és mindaddig, amíg ragaszkodik az utasításokhoz, nem lehetnek problémák. Ez azt jelenti, hogy ha még soha nem dolgoztál vele, érdemes elolvasni, hogyan kell használni a rendszerleíróadatbázis-szerkesztőt, mielőtt elkezdené. És a változtatás előtt határozottan készítsen biztonsági másolatot a rendszerleíró adatbázisról (és a számítógépéről!).
Nyissa meg a Rendszerleíróadatbázis-szerkesztőt a Start gomb megnyomásával és írja be a „regedit” parancsot. Nyomja meg az Enter billentyűt a Rendszerleíróadatbázis-szerkesztő megnyitásához, és engedélyt ad a számítógép módosítására.
Ugyanazokat a változásokat készítheti a nyilvántartásban két helyen. Az első hely hozzáadja a „Take Ownership” -t a helyi menüben bármilyen típusú fájlhoz, és a második hely hozzáadja a parancsot a mappák helyi menüjéhez.
Adja hozzá a „Take Ownership” parancsot a Fájlok menüjéhez
A Rendszerleíróadatbázis-szerkesztőben a bal oldali sáv használatával navigálhat a következő kulcsra:
HKEY_CLASSES_ROOT \ * \ shell
Ezután egy új kulcsot hoz létre a héj
kulcs. Kattintson a jobb gombbal a héj
gombot, és válassza az Új> Kulcs parancsot. Adja meg az új kulcsot „runas”. Ha már látja a runas
kulcs belsejében héj
gombot, kihagyhatja ezt a lépést.
Ezután meg fogod változtatni (Alapértelmezett)
érték a runas
kulcs. A ... val runas
gomb megnyomásával kattintson duplán a (Alapértelmezett)
értékét a tulajdonságok ablak megnyitásához.
A Tulajdonságok ablakban írja be a „Vételadatok” mezőbe a „Take Ownership” -t, majd kattintson az „OK” gombra. Az itt megadott érték lesz a helyi menüben látható parancs, ezért nyugodtan változtassa meg azt, amit akar.
Ezután egy új értéket hoz létre a runas
kulcs. Kattintson a jobb gombbal a runas
gombot, és válassza az Új> String érték lehetőséget. Adja meg az új értéket „NoWorkingDirectory”.
Most egy új kulcsot fogsz létrehozni a runas
kulcs. Kattintson a jobb gombbal a runas
gombot, és válassza az Új> Kulcs parancsot. Adja meg az új kulcs „parancsot”.
Az új parancs
gomb megnyomásával kattintson duplán a (Alapértelmezett)
értéket a jobb oldali ablaktáblán a tulajdonságok ablak megnyitásához.
Az „Értékadatok” mezőbe írja be (vagy másolja be és illessze be a következő szöveget), majd kattintson az „OK” gombra.
cmd.exe / c takeown / f "% 1" & & icacls "% 1" / támogatási rendszergazdák: F
Most egy új értéket kell létrehoznia a parancsgombon belül. Kattintson a jobb gombbal a parancsgombra, és válassza az Új> String érték lehetőséget. Adja meg az „IsolatedCommand” új értéket, majd kattintson duplán a tulajdonságablak megnyitásához.
Az „Értékadatok” mezőbe írja be (vagy másolja be és illessze be a következő szöveget), majd kattintson az „OK” gombra. Ne feledje, hogy ez ugyanaz a parancs, amelyet éppen hozzáadtunk az (Alapértelmezett) értékhez.
cmd.exe / c takeown / f "% 1" & & icacls "% 1" / támogatási rendszergazdák: F
Ez pedig hozzáadja a „Take Ownership” parancsot a fájlok helyi menüjéhez. Folytassuk a változtatásokat, amelyekre a parancsokat a mappák menüjéhez kell hozzáadni.
Adja hozzá a „Take Ownership” parancsot a mappák kontextusmenüjéhez
A „Take Ownership” parancsmappák hozzáadásához lényegében ugyanazokat a változtatásokat hajtja végre, amelyeket az előző részben tettél, de a nyilvántartás egy másik helyére. A Rendszerleíróadatbázis-szerkesztőben a bal oldali sáv használatával navigálhat a következő kulcsra:
HKEY_CLASSES_ROOT \ Directory \ shell
Ezután egy új kulcsot hoz létre a héj
kulcs. Kattintson a jobb gombbal a héj
gombot, és válassza az Új> Kulcs parancsot. Adja meg az új kulcsot „runas”. Ha már látja a runas
kulcs belsejében héj
gombot, kihagyhatja ezt a lépést.
Ezután meg fogod változtatni (Alapértelmezett)
érték a runas
kulcs. A ... val runas
gomb megnyomásával kattintson duplán a (Alapértelmezett)
értékét a tulajdonságok ablak megnyitásához.
A Tulajdonságok ablakban írja be a „Vételadatok” mezőbe a „Take Ownership” -t, majd kattintson az „OK” gombra. Az itt megadott érték lesz a helyi menüben látható parancs, ezért nyugodtan változtassa meg azt, amit akar.
Ezután egy új értéket hoz létre a runas
kulcs. Kattintson a jobb gombbal a runas
gombot, és válassza az Új> String érték lehetőséget. Adja meg az új értéket „NoWorkingDirectory”.
Most egy új kulcsot fogsz létrehozni a runas
kulcs. Kattintson a jobb gombbal a runas
gombot, és válassza az Új> Kulcs parancsot. Adja meg az új kulcs „parancsot”.
Az új parancs
gomb megnyomásával kattintson duplán a (Alapértelmezett)
értéket a jobb oldali ablaktáblán a tulajdonságok ablak megnyitásához.
Az „Értékadatok” mezőbe írja be (vagy másolja be és illessze be a következő szöveget), majd kattintson az „OK” gombra.
cmd.exe / c takeown / f "% 1" / r / d y && icacls "% 1" / támogatási rendszergazdák: F / t
Most egy új értéket kell létrehoznia a parancsgombon belül. Kattintson a jobb gombbal a parancsgombra, és válassza az Új> String érték lehetőséget. Adja meg az „IsolatedCommand” új értéket, majd kattintson duplán a tulajdonságablak megnyitásához.
Az „Értékadatok” mezőbe írja be (vagy másolja be és illessze be a következő szöveget), majd kattintson az „OK” gombra. Ne feledje, hogy ez ugyanaz a parancs, amelyet éppen hozzáadtunk az (Alapértelmezett) értékhez.
cmd.exe / c takeown / f "% 1" / r / d y && icacls "% 1" / támogatási rendszergazdák: F / t
És végül elkészült. A rendszerleíróadatbázis-szerkesztőt bezárhatja. Ezek a változtatások azonnal megtörténjenek, ezért próbáld ki azt a jobb egérgombbal bármely fájl vagy mappa segítségével, és győződj meg róla, hogy megjelenik a „Take Ownership” parancs.
Ha bármikor meg akarja változtatni a változtatásokat, csak fejezze be a rendszerleíró adatbázist, és törölje a runas
mindkét helyen létrehozott kulcsok. Ez azt is törli, hogy mindent, amit belül létrehozott. Ha már van runas
gombok ezeken a helyeken - például más hack-eket használtunk - csak törölje a parancs
gombok helyett.
Töltse le az egykattintásos rendszerleíró adatbázisokat
Sok lépés van, ha ezt a hacket manuálisan hajtja végre, ezért nem hibáztatjuk, hogy szeretné használni a gyorsabb eljárást. Ha nem érzed magad, mint a búvárkodás, akkor létrehoztunk néhány hacket, amiket használhatsz. A „Add Take Ownership to Context Menu” (Hozzon létre tulajdonjogot a helyi menübe) hack létrehozza a kulcsokat és értékeket, amelyekkel hozzáadhatja a „Take Ownership” parancsot. A „Take Take Ownership from Context Menu (alapértelmezett)” törli ezeket a kulcsokat, eltávolítja a parancsot és visszaállítja az alapértelmezett beállítást. Mindkét hacket a következő ZIP fájl tartalmazza. Kattintson duplán a használni kívántra, és kattintson az utasításokra.
Vegye fel a tulajdonosi menüt
Ezek a hackek valójában csak az runas
kulcs, az előző részben leírt új kulcsok és értékek leeresztése, majd az .REG fájlba exportálás. A hackek futtatása csak létrehozza vagy törli a gombokat a parancs hozzáadásához a helyi menübe. És ha örülsz a Hivatalnak, érdemes időt szánni arra, hogy megtanulod, hogyan készíthetsz saját nyilvántartást.